In the spring of 2003, three ingenue filmmakers (Jason Russell, Bobby Bailey, and Laren Poole) traveled to Africa in search of a story.
They produced a documentary that tells the tragedy that revolves around Africa's longest running war, where children have become the victims and the weapons.
Rebel armies, known as the Lord's Resistance Army(LRA), have been abducting children and using them as troops while they wage war against the Ugandan government. This originally caused the children to night commute, or walk miles nightly to avoid these troops. It is estimated that 90% of the LRA is abducted children. The film tells their story
